Holiday Gifts to Make

This year the ELS classes at Cumberland are making polymer clay pens to give as a holiday gift to someone special. I have done this project with numerous groups, and they always turn out GREAT! Here are the directions, and a link for a spiral pen that can be found on the Sculpey website.

You will need: Sculpy Clay
                        Bic Round Stick Pens (it has to be this kind, as others will melt when baked)
                        Pliers

1. Use the pliers to pop the ink out of the center of the round stick pen.

2. Knead Sculpey clay to soften.

3. Push clay all over the pen (except the opening) however you would like using coils and mixing clay together to make interesting designs in the clay.


4. Roll out to smooth the clay. Make keep pressing the clay against the pen, as it comes loose when rolling.

5. When covered, preheat oven to 250 degrees.

6. Bake for 15 minutes at 250. Be careful to not over bake the pens, as they will burn.

7. Let cool, and put the ink back in the center.

8. Wrap them up and give as a gift!
